BIG 8 – BIG SWIMS
The Big 8 held December 19 at legendary C.T. Branin Natatorium (site of OHSAA State Meet), produced some of the most competitive races in the State. And the AquaBombers were right in the mix finishing a close second to defending State champs Columbus St. Charles. Top 4 scores:
St. Charles 350
St. X 336
Mason 300.5
St. Ignatius 234.5
Senior
Chase Grisi (200 IM), junior
Tucker Charles (100 Back) and sophomore
Owen Gee (500 Free) claimed gold. Grisi's time was the 18
th fastest in school history.
The following were multiple medalists:
- Charles (200 Medley Relay, 100 Back, 400 Free Relay)
- Gee (200 Medley Relay, 100 Fly, 500 Free, 400 Free Relay)
- Grisi (200 IM, 100 Fly, 200 Free Relay, 400 Free Relay)
- Andrew Clippard [SR] (200 Medley Relay, 200 Free Relay)
- Sam DeMarco [SR] (200 Free Relay, 400 Free Relay)
- Alex Nixon [SR] (200 Free, 400 Free Relay)
